Norman Vincent Peale


"Imagination is the true magic carpet."












Author, Minister


1898 - 1993






 



Our minds are very powerful.  What we imagine, think and say can impact what we do.  Creative leaders should use their imagination not only for their creative work, but also for their personal lives.  Can you see yourself as a successful writer, artist or actor?  Can you see yourself sitting at a desk typing that great novel or standing at a easel painting your best painting?





Do you want to change some habit or relationship?  Begin by imagining yourself in a new role or relationship.  See yourself successfully behaving in a new way.  We call this positive visualization.  Most of us already do negative visualization.  Do you ever worry about the future?  Worry is a negative form of visualization.





Through the process of visualization we can change who we are.  This is the power of positive thinking.  The easiest thing in the world is to be negative.  It takes a lot more will power to be positive in a negative world.  I challenge you to take five minutes each day and visualize your success.
